    Fig. 1 – My CNC set up

    I like to use the router for cutting out pieces but I find that engraving is better using the Dremel tool as shown in figure 1, it’s much quieter too. My machine has a workable area of 350mm x 220mm so it can quite easily handle any panel or throttle quadrant part.

    Prerequisites
    Hardware - Do I mention a CNC machine here or is that too obvious? I think you will really need one of those! A vertical bandsaw, table saw or jigsaw to cut out the raw materials required. A 3mm endmill and a 3mm 25 degree 0.5mm tip engraving tool. The material I use is 4.5mm thick Opal Acrylic sheeting, a 2.4m x 1.2m sheet cost ...
